Q: New complex owners say they have done a Termination of Association and that my current lease is void? can this be done?

I signed lease with property management company that owned a townhouse in the complex which has been bought out, new owners paid management company for the unit, now they are saying my lease which is good until 3/31/2018 is void, that this was not a buy out that they did a Termination of HOA and that makes the lease invalid. There a no clauses in my lease referring to this or any sort of early termination except for non payment.

A: Your situation is more complex than this forum is intended to deal with.

You need to consult with a real estate attorney from the area where your rental property is located.

Without reviewing your lease my initial thought is that the company cannot legally take this action. But hire a lawyer to look into it.
